JAVA編程基礎(1-31)測試題_第1頁
JAVA編程基礎(1-31)測試題_第2頁
JAVA編程基礎(1-31)測試題_第3頁
JAVA編程基礎(1-31)測試題_第4頁
JAVA編程基礎(1-31)測試題_第5頁
已閱讀5頁,還剩5頁未讀, 繼續免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1、JAVA編程基礎(1-31)1、(10*(2-8)+10)/(5-5*2)在JAVA語言中,上面的表達式計算結果為(選一項)() 單選題 *A、-10B、10(正確答案)C、30D、-322、閱讀下面的Java代碼int arr;int n = 5;n = n * 2 +1;arr = new intn;System.out.println(arr.length);程序輸出的結果是(選一項)() 單選題 *A、5B、8C、10D、11(正確答案)3、在 Java 語言中 , 下面 () 轉義序列表示換行。(選一項) 單選題 *A、aB、n(正確答案)C、rD、f4、在 JAVA編程中,Java

2、編譯器會將Java源代碼程序轉換為(選一項)() 單選題 *A、字節碼(正確答案)B、可執行代碼C、機器代碼D、以上所有選項都不正確5、在 Java語言中,下列代碼片段的輸出結果是(選一項)()float a = 50;int b = 4;float c = a/b;System.out.println(c); 單選題 *A、0B、12C、12.0D、12.5(正確答案)6、在Java 語言中,下列代碼的輸出結果是(選一項)()public static void main(String args) int i=5, j=10;do if(ij) break;j-;i+;while(j!=i)

3、;System.out.println( i + , + j); 單選題 *A、8,7(正確答案)B、9,6C、7,6D、7,87、在Java 語言中定義了如下變量:double x=10.0; y=3.0;int z=2;下面強制轉換符都發生了作用,除了(選一項)() 單選題 *A、(int)(x+y/z);B、(double)(x/y);(正確答案)C、(int)x;D、(int)(y+z);8、在JAVA編程中,源代碼文件的擴展名為(選一項)() 單選題 *A、.classB、.java(正確答案)C、.comD、以上所有選項都不正確9、在JAVA語言中描述A:8與8是相同的描述B:¥的

4、數據類型是char下面的選項()是正確的(選一項) 單選題 *A、兩個描述都是正確的B、只有描述A是正確的C、兩個描述都是錯誤的D、只有描述B是正確的(正確答案)10、public static void showInfo(int a,int b) a+; b+;public static void main(String args) int a = 5;int b = 10;System.out.println(a + , + b);showInfo(a,b); System.out.println(a + , + b);在JAVA語言中, 上列代碼的運行結果是(選一項)() 單選題 *A、

5、5,10 5,10(正確答案)B、5,10 6,11C、5,10 4,11D、5,10 5,1111、在JAVA語言中,()語句可以結束本次循環而不會結束整個循環。(選一項) 單選題 *A、nextB、continue(正確答案)C、switchD、break12、在JAVA語言中,3/5的值是(選一項)() 單選題 *A、1B、0(正確答案)C、2D、0.613、在Java語言中,5/3的值是(選一項)() 單選題 *A、1(正確答案)B、1C、2D、1.6714、在Java語言中,假設以下所有變量均為整型,則下列代碼執行后c的值是(選一項)()a=2;b=5;b+;c=a+b; 單選題 *

6、A、5B、6C、7D、8(正確答案)15、在Java語言中,經過如下運算后,num的值為(選一項)()int num = 0;num = 23?0:1; 單選題 *A、0B、1(正確答案)C、2D、316、在JAVA語言中,靜態變量用()修飾的。(選一項) 單選題 *A、static(正確答案)B、finalC、abstractD、interface17、在Java語言中,能正確表示a和b同時為正或同時為負的表達式是(選一項)(B) 單選題 *A、(a =0 | b = 0) & (a 0 | b 0(正確答案)C、(a + b 0) & (a + b = 0 & b = 0) & (a 0

7、& b 0)18、在Java語言中,下列()是合法的標示符(選兩項) *A、$95(正確答案)B、_wii(正確答案)C、3pspD、break;19、在JAVA語言中,下列()是合法的標示符(選兩項) *A、Main(正確答案)B、p234(正確答案)C、4xD、short20、在JAVA語言中,下列JAVA語言代碼的循環體執行的次數是(選一項)()int n=2;while(n = 0)System.out.println(n); n-; 單選題 *A、0(正確答案)B、1C、2D、321、在Java語言中,下列變量定義和賦值錯誤的是(選一項)() 單選題 *A、short i=5;int

8、 j=i;B、char c = c; int j=c;(正確答案)C、float f = c+1;D、float i=5; double d=i;22、在Java語言中,下列表達式的運算的結果是(選一項)( )10/2 +5%10; 單選題 *A、5B、7C、10(正確答案)D、1223、在Java語言中,下列代碼的輸出結果是(選一項)()public static void main(String args) int num=10,20,51,40,50; System.out.println(num2); 單選題 *A、40B、50C、51(正確答案)D、6024、在JAVA語言中,下列代

9、碼的輸出結果是(選一項)()public static void main(String args)int i,j=0; for(i=1;i10;i+)if(i%4=0) continue; j =i; System.out.println(i + , + j); 單選題 *A、10,9(正確答案)B、3,6C、10,8D、4,1025、在Java語言中,下列代碼的運行結果是(選一項)()int a = 1, sum = 0;while (a 3) sum = sum + a; a+;System.out.println(sum); 單選題 *A、2B、3(正確答案)C、4D、以上都不對26、

10、在JAVA語言中,下列代碼的運行結果是(選一項)()public static void main(String args) int stuAge = 18,22,26;int i, avgAge = 0; for(i = 0; i b)if(bc) c=a+b;else c=a*b;System.out.println( a + t + b + t + c); 單選題 *A、1 3 5(正確答案)B、1 3 4C、1 3 6D、1 3 328、在Java語言中,下列對于字符數組的定義并賦值正確的是(選一項)() 單選題 *A、char name = new char4;B、char name = S,V,S,E;(正確答案)C、char4 name = SVSE;D、char4 name = S,V,S,E;29、在Java語言中,下列關于方法的優點,說法錯誤的是(選一項)() 單選題 *A、通過使用方法,可以提供程序開發的效率B、通過使用方法,可以提高代碼的重用性C、通過使用方法,使得程序的維護變得復雜(正確答案)D、通過使用方法,使得程序的變得簡短和清晰30

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論